We show that tests for a break in the persistence of a time series in the classicalI(0) - I(1) framework have serious size distortions when the actual data generatingprocess exhibits long-range dependencies. We prove that the limiting distributionof a CUSUM of squares based test depends on the...

We analyze the cross-national distribution of GDP per capita and its evolutionfrom 1970 to 2003. We argue that peaks are not a suitable measure for distinctgrowth regimes, because the number of peaks is not invariant under strictlymonotonic transformations of the data (e.g. original vs. log...

Atheoretical regression trees (ART) are applied to detect changes in the mean of a stationarylong memory time series when location and number are unknown. It is shownthat the BIC, which is almost always used as a pruning method, does not operate well inthe long memory framework.[...]
